The Church in Galatiawas made up of an interesting group of people. Paul had visited the area and established churches in what many believe was the southern part of the region. Sometime after his second visit Paul wrote a letter to the believers because of concerns he had for the faith of those he had taught the Good News. His love and deep concern for the churches in the area continued throughout his life.
